Using the SecurityCenter Protection status at a glance When you want to... Do this... Check your action items and alerts Problems that require your attention appear in red. The method for resolving them varies depending on the page. • Click the button at the end of the text to display instructions for resolving the problem. • In a computer listing, click the name of the computer to display details about it, then click the action item. Display details about a computer Send email to a computer Filter information on a page Click a computer name in a listing. Click an email address in the listing to open a blank, preaddressed message. (You must have a local email application installed to use this feature.) At the top of a page, select the information to display (such as group name, period of time, or type of information). TIP: For greater flexibility in managing large accounts, select whether to display groups or individual computers. Sort information in listings Click a column heading to sort by that column. Click it again to switch the order in which it is displayed (ascending order or descending order). Protection status at a glance The Dashboard page is your "home" page on the SecurityCenter website - a graphical overview of your coverage with instant access to summary information about the computers and subscriptions in your account. Access the Dashboard page at any time by clicking the Dashboard tab. • Install additional protection. • V iew and resolve action items. • V iew protection coverage and activity for all computers or specific groups with interactive reports (known as widgets) containing clickable charts and links. • C heck and update your subscriptions and licenses. • S elect, resize, and reposition the widgets that appear on the page. • A ccess associated protection portals by clicking a link (available only when your account includes email protection or vulnerability scanning).
